Paris: J.B. Bailliere, 1824. First Edition. Hardcover. Very Good. Full leather hardback with gilt lettered label; head, tail and joints rubbed and worn, but still showing well and holding firm. Contents age toned and occasionally spotted, especially the title-page, with also just a couple of very small King's Inn library stamps. Size: 8vo. Collation: pp. [2], 233, complete with 2 engraved plates. Bound with a second work by Achille Richard published in 1825: Nouveaux Elements de Botanique et de Physiologie Vegetale (pp. xxiv, 519, complete with 8 engraved plates). Thus 2 titles in 1 book. Note, the first work by Dutrochet is a very scarce landmark study: "Dutrochet asserted that respiration follows the same pattern in both animals and plants, showing that the minute openings on the surface of leaves (the stomata) communicate with lacunae in deeper tissue. He also demonstrated that only the green parts of the plant can absorb carbon dioxide, thereby transforming light energy into chemical energy. (See: Garrison-Morton: 110)
